Livi Aid Live Founder, Linda Tierney, Passes Away
The motion
That the Parliament notes with sadness the passing of Linda Tierney, an integral founder of Livi Aid Live, a Livingston music festival that has helped raise thousands of pounds for Marie Curie Hospice Edinburgh since its formation; acknowledges that Linda’s service came in spite of her own diagnosis with terminal cancer; commends her selfless dedication to the charity, and for the all the hard work she put into the community; recognises that her passing is a sad loss and she will be greatly missed, and sends its condolences to her friends, family, and all who knew her.
